It is a Mercedes, you need the dealership, an auto electrician or an Auto locksmith / Alarm installer. It is the most electrically over-engineered brand on the market. some are PIN Locked so that only registered technicians can reset based on VIN Number.
You should have a code for the radio in your owner;s manual. If you are not the original owner and it is not there, the dealer should be able to provide it from your VIN.
The code should be on a card that came with the owners manual. Usually everything is located in the leather case assuming the procedures are the same there as well as other locations. Otherwise, you will have to call the dealer and provide them with VIN and what other information they request for proof of ownership.
